'Deeply saddened: PM Modi tweets on General Bipin Rawat's death
Prime Minister Narendra Modi expressed he is deeply deep saddened over the sudden death of General Bipin Rawat, the country's first Chief of Defence Staff, whose helicopter crashed in Tamil Nadu's Coonoor this morning. The Prime Minister tweeted, 'I am deeply anguished by the helicopter crash in Tamil Nadu in which we have lost Gen Bipin Rawat, his wife and other personnel of the Armed Forces. They served India with utmost diligence. My thoughts are with the bereaved families'.
